High-back seats with headrests improve consolation but might require higher pitch (distance between rows), limiting whole rely. Additionally, wheelchair lifts or mobility ramps take up ground space, decreasing complete seating capability by 1–3 seats. Wider aisles reduce out there space for seats. Safety standards require a minimal aisle width—typically 15 inches (38 cm) within the U.S.—to permit for emergency evacuation. Some vehicles may physically match extra seats, however local laws might restrict occupancy based on door placement, aisle width, or emergency exits ⚠️. It Is important to tell apart between seating capacity and authorized passenger limit.
